My boyfriend found this cool hanging lamp at a garage sale and thought I could spiff it up and give it some life.

Image

The lamp shade is made out of wicker, so I could obviously spray paint it. Just wondering if there are any other more exciting ideas for sprucing this lamp up??

:D I LOVE this shade. The possibilities are endless. My first impression of it was to paint it and then using a utility knife, cut out different shapes. (Ex. Possibly some retro flowers.) Attach a piece of translucent fabric or a vellum paper on the inside of the shade to soften the design up. Add a low watt bulb and admire. :)

One more thought and I think I like this one a bit more. Paint the shade the base color of choice. Next, take and draw a floral motif or some other design on the shade using chalk. Step #3 Following the pattern you just drew use different colors of fibers such as yarn, ribbon, or embroidery floss to fill in the pattern you created. Just weave the fibers up and through the openings in the shade. This process may be a bit more timely but the effect would be oh so grande!! :)
